Abilities
Peak Physical Conditioning: While not on the same scale as Batman, Nightwing, or others who have devoted their entire lives to maximizing their physical potential, Oliver is in terrific physical condition. Stronger, faster and more agile than your average human, he is able to get around the city by rooftop with little difficulty, support his own weight on a rope for an indefinite amount of time, and has undertaken a strict dietary and conditioning regimen since his return from Starfish Island to further improve his physical capabilities.
Archery: Perhaps one of the finest archers on the planet, his ability to pinpoint targets borders on supernatural; with a careful shot, he can strike a bullseye from almost any distance within the range of his bow. Even off-the-cuff shots strike with significant accurancy, and he can fire nearly two dozen arrows a minute at a target within fifty feet without missing his intended mark by more than a couple of inches in any direction; this speed, of course, is hampered by simple logistics, as he will exhaust his supply of arrows in about two minutes at that rate. He seems to have an innate skill at adjusting his aim and technique to compensate for a variety of arrowheads, even ones that aren't remotely aerodynamic, having even stuck a beer bottle on an arrowshaft as a makeshift projectile.
Hunter: His time on Starfish Island taught him the benefits of stealth, and learning how to stalk and track your prey. Whether an animal, or a common street thug, the brash Queen is quite good at getting around unnoticed when he has to, and tailing someone without being spotted.
Unarmed Combat And Swordsmanship: Along with improving his archery skills, his mentor also taught him a variety of fighting techniques, creating a mixed style that makes Oliver pretty effective in a fight. While not on par with those such as Batman, he has been able to hold his own against other skilled fighters, and is exceptionally skilled with a sword.
Filthy Rich?: Though technically not an ability, it's hard to deny that Oliver's wealth offers a significant resource, as does the connections the Queen family has established over the years. Whether it's funding his vigilante operations, or using his family name to get information or access that would be denied others, Oliver isn't above subtly using his company to accomplish alterior motives.
Equipment
Costume: With a throat-worn voice modulator that allows him to speak in a deeper baritone, the costume's seemingly sparse material is in fact constructed from durable kevlar-weave plates, affording him moderate protection against sharp weapons, and significant protection against gunfire. The fact that his arms remain bare are due more to the fact that he needs full mobility to ply his craft, but his legs and torso are afforded plenty of protection, with extra-thick layers on his back. His hood affixed to his skull with a special adhesive compound, allowing it to remain on regardless of how extensive his acrobatic maneuvers are.
Bows: At the moment, Green Arrow has two forms of bow, depending on the sort of shots he intends to fire on a given outing; the first is a simple, but finely crafted one, simple and without any special sights or adornments. The string is uncommonly strong, making the likelihood of it snapping- or even being cut with a conventional blade- highly unlikely. It is easily fitted to his back, along with his quiver, and is relatively small, making it easily portable and ideal for close-quarters wielding. This bow is best suited for medium-to-short range combat, dealing with the bulk of Arrow's opponents
The second bow is a bit more specialized; a compound, collapsible bow, it has a range of nearly a mile, and is fitted with a powerful optical scope. This serves him best at extremely long ranges, when he is providing cover fire for other heroes or seeking to serve other purposes from afar. This one doesn't see as much use, as its relatively bulky and unwieldy size at full extension makes it fairly useless for a pitched battle.
Quiver: Capable of holding fifty arrows, the quiver is surprisingly compact for its capacity, and of customized design; the most noticeable portion is the lowest half, where the arrowheads are stored. Each standard arrow is outfitted with a sharp, extremely tough custom-alloy arrowhead, with the ability to 'hook' to an alternate blunted head that completely covers the sharp tip. These arrows are all locked into the quiver, so that Oliver's acrobatic movements don't shake them loose; when he wishes to extract an arrow, he need only rotate the shaft to one side with two fingers to unlock it before pulling it free. If he turns it to the left, the entire arrow (with the blunted head covering the tip) will be removed. If he turns it to the right, the blunted tip will remain locked inside, producing a sharp arrow instead. Constant practise has allowed him to remove arrows, in any variation, without hesitation or delay, helping contribute to his incredible rate-of-fire.
One side of the quiver has a line of high-strength, thin table that can be attached to any one of his arrows; once fired, it creates a long-distance cord that Oliver can either swing or, if attached to his grounding point, slide down. The bottom of the quiver is also packed with a significant amount of explosive material; when a special release is triggered, the entire thing detonates, creating an extremely powerful explosion far more potent than even his explosive arrows. This is generally considered a 'last-ditch' effort, used as a distraction or a weapon when he has expended his supply of arrows.
Trick Arrows: When on a standard patrol run, Oliver will mostly wield standard sharp/blunt arrows, five gas arrows, and one or two of each other. However, the composition of his quiver can change depending on what he's expecting to encounter; more superhuman foes, for example, may warrant more gas and explosive arrows. The fletching on each arrow has its own distinct pattern and texture, allowing him to find the arrow he needs by touch alone. Inventive and innovative, Oliver is often tinkering with new arrow designs, but there are a few standbys he falls back on;
Blunt Arrow: As mentioned, the custom quiver allows Oliver to remove an arrow with either a sharp point, or a blunted end; the blunted version allows Oliver to target an opponent's solar plexus, temple, or other soft points to incapacitate or injure them without causing lasting damage. Although there is a small chance that getting a blunted arrow to the temple can leave the target with a mild concussion, Oliver is usually careful to moderate the force of the shot to compensate. Blunted arrows are also substantially easier to collect and re-use, as they won't get lodged in his target.
Gas Arrow: With a hollow arrowhead, there are two variations of design, depending on the type of gas being used; some will explode in an immediate puff of thick smoke, providing visual cover when necessary. Others, usually tear gas or sedative arrows, will release a 'hiss' of potent gas from vents in the size of the arrowhead; a single arrow is sufficient to fill a large room with thick smoke or gas, and often they will have an adhesive tip to stick to walls or enemies prior to release.
Taser Arrow: With a potent battery, and thin, barbed leads that hook into whatever flesh they strike, the taser arrow has a varying voltage, depending on the sort of target Oliver intends it for. From a jolt strong enough to knock a human senseless, to a devastating charge that can leave even invulnerable metahumans aching, he will usually bring these arrows only when he knows exactly who he is going after.
Explosive Arrow: Oliver has two variations of explosive arrow; the first is a conventional 'boom' arrow that immediately detonates upon contact with a target, causing a great big impressive detonation. The second actually has the explosive fitted a couple of inches down the shaft, with an armor-piercing, sharp arrowhead designed to punch through steel plating. This is best suited against robotic opponents, as the arrow will first penetrate the armor, driving the explosive inside the droid's vulnerable innards, and then detonate.
Glue Arrow: With a compressed, fast-hardening adhesive polymer that rapidly expands upon contact with air, the Glue Arrow is ideal for immobilizing foes. It can restrain any humans, and even those with peak-human or superhuman strength can have some difficulty escaping for a few minutes, as before the glue hardens completely, it will be sticky and stretch rather than break.
Surveillance Arrow: With a blunt, adhesive tip, the arrow contains a very durable, wireless microphone keyed to a frequency that Oliver can pick up on an earpiece receiver he carries. The special, soft tip absorbs sound, making the impact almost silent, and the microphone picks up sounds as far as seventy feet away, making it ideal for listening in to conversations.
Weaknesses
Human: Although in excellent physical condition, he's still human, with any resilience to knives, gunfire, etc, afforded by his kevlar-padded suit. Beyond that, he'd no more resistant to blunt force trauma, acid or other forms of assault than any other human.
Finite Ammunition:[/b] Under ideal circumstances, using only blunted arrows, Oliver could theoretically retrieve all the ammunition he has fired, doubling, tripling or even quadrupling his available stockpile before the stress of repeated impacts finally leaves them useless. However, in the event he's forced into a running battle, rely on sharp arrows, or expend them on targets too distant to reach for retrieval, Oliver's stockpile of ammunition can dwindle with surprising speed, and once it's gone, his combat effectiveness is severely reduced, as even with his unarmed combat skill, he isn't close to the fighter Batman or other pure martial artists are.
Caught Unprepared:[/i] When out confronting conventional street crime, fully four-fifths of Oliver's ammunition will be simply sharp/blunted arrows. He'll have perhaps one or two of each specialty arrow, but that's it for special ammunition. If confronted with a foe possessing invulnerability, (without having taken time to pack first,) Oliver might only have a few arrows that can do any damage at all, leaving him with over forty useless duds and an explosive quiver that would rapidly become his last, best hope.
